Purple red color.
The nose is open and offers a cocktail of red fruits.
The mouth is mineral and fine.
This wine offers an alliance between woody notes and black fruit.
Simmered dishes, red meats.
"If you've never tried Malbec from the Loire, start with this bottle. Deep-purple in color, this wine has an aromatic nose of blackberry, blueberry, black tea, rhubarb and cranberry with hints of dried hay. Velvety in texture, the wine is firm, flavorsome and brings together a cacophony of elements that lend complexity. — Reggie SOLOMON"
- Wine Enthusiast (October 2023), 90 pts
